Output 0586a05876c9942bd14029bca5a3a8f8ce0a13ea8663c18bc905cd30659bd50d:1

value
28700559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ad3aa729bce4587abcea2f3853994d4f92476b63 OP_EQUAL
address
3HUy61b6yKuVPx4ro2fjQAzwLBsN4j2Mp4
transaction
0586a05876c9942bd14029bca5a3a8f8ce0a13ea8663c18bc905cd30659bd50d
spent
true